Exploring Popular Brazilian Baby Names

Brazilian baby names frequently showcase the country's diverse heritage, influenced by Indigenous, African, and Portuguese cultures. This results in a beautiful array of names that carry deep meanings and unique sounds.
For instance, names like "Gabriel" and "Sofia" are popular due to their religious significance and melodic qualities. Others, such as "Ana" or "Mateus," emphasize simplicity while maintaining a classic charm.
What are some unique Brazilian baby names?
Many parents seek names that stand out. "Isadora," meaning "gift of Isis," and "Thiago," which is derived from "James," embody this desire for uniqueness while honoring beautiful traditions.

Cultural Significance of Brazilian Names

The choice of a name in Brazilian culture can also reflect familial bonds, carrying the names of grandparents or ancestors as a sign of respect and love. This naming tradition symbolizes the continuity of family lineage.
Additionally, many Brazilian names have their roots in significant historical figures or events, which can serve as a powerful narrative for your child’s identity.
Why do people choose traditional Brazilian names?
Traditional names often hold emotional weight, connecting children to their family history. For many families, names like "Luis" or "Maria" are chosen to honor previous generations.

Tips for Choosing Brazilian Baby Names

When selecting a name, consider factors such as pronunciation, meaning, and how it flows with your last name. Think about the initials and any potential nicknames that could arise from the choice.
It can be helpful to write down a list of names you love and say them aloud to see how they feel. Also, consider talking with family members to gather insights or suggestions.
How can I ensure the name has a positive meaning?
Research the meanings of names. Websites and baby name books often provide definitions, so you can select a name that resonates with positive ideals or characteristics.
